WASHINGTON (AP) — Vice President Kamala Harris on Friday slammed the report by a Justice Department particular counsel into Joe Biden’s mishandling of categorized paperwork that raised questions in regards to the president’s reminiscence, calling it “politically motivated” and “gratuitous,” because the White House stated the president would take steps to safeguard categorized supplies throughout presidential transitions.

The report from Robert Hur, the previous Maryland U.S. Attorney chosen by Attorney General Merrick Garland to analyze Biden discovered proof that Biden willfully held onto and shared with a ghostwriter extremely categorized data, however laid out why he didn’t imagine the proof met the usual for prison prices, together with a excessive likelihood that the Justice Department wouldn’t be capable of show Biden’s intent past an inexpensive doubt.

The White House has stated Biden erred in having the paperwork in his residence and Ian Sams, a spokesperson for the White House counsel’s workplace, stated on Friday that Biden would quickly identify a process drive “to ensure that there are better processes in place” to guard categorized supplies when administrations change.

The Hur report described the 81-year-old Democrat’s reminiscence as “hazy,” “fuzzy,” “faulty,” “poor” and having “significant limitations.” It famous that Biden couldn’t recall defining milestones in his personal life equivalent to when his son Beau died or when he served as vp.

Asked whether or not the White House would launch a duplicate of the transcript of Biden’s interview with Hur that would dispute Hur’s characterizations, Sams stated elements of it had been categorized, however that if elements of it may very well be declassified, “we’ll take a look at that and make a determination.”

Taking a query from a reporter on the conclusion of a gun violence prevention occasion on the White House, Harris stated that as a former prosecutor, she thought of Hur’s feedback “gratuitous, inaccurate, and inappropriate.”

She famous that Biden’s two-day sit-down with Hur occurred simply after the Oct. 7 assault by Hamas on Israel, the place greater than 1,200 folks had been killed and about 250 had been taken hostage — together with many Americans.

“It was an intense moment for the commander in chief of the United States of America,” Harris stated, saying she spent numerous hours with Biden and different officers within the days that adopted and he was “on top of it all.”

She added that “the way that the president’s demeanor in that report was characterized could not be more wrong on the facts and clearly politically motivated, gratuitous.”

Harris concluded saying a particular counsel ought to have a “higher level of integrity than what we saw.”

Her feedback got here a day after Biden insisted that his “memory is fine.” and grew visibly indignant on the White House, as he denied forgetting when his son died. Beau Biden died of mind most cancers in 2015 on the age of 46.

Sams recommended that the political setting led Hur, who was appointed as U.S. legal professional by former President Donald Trump, to incorporate the feedback. “There’s an environment that we are in, that generates a ton of pressure, because you have congressional Republicans, other Republicans, attacking prosecutors that they don’t like,” he stated.
